Installing Optical Modules
Do not insert the optical module with optical fibers directly into an optical interface. You need to install the optical module first and then the optical fibers.
The Difference Between Single/Dual Fiber and Single/Multi-Mode Optical
Dual fiber modules use two separate fibers: one for transmitting (TX) and one for receiving (RX). This is the most common setup and is widely supported in standard optical networking.
